Matte black design. Ergonomic controller design with Nintendo Switch button layout. Detachable 10ft (3m) USB cable with hook-and-loop strap. Play your favorite Nintendo Switch games* in style with this officially licensed PowerA wired controller. This controller features our latest ergonomic design and intuitive button layout. A detachable 10ft USB cable with a hook-and-loop strap is included for easy storage and reduced clutter. Plus, PowerA backs all products for 2-years to reinforce quality commitment.. Input device.
